64 archlinux run steam

1. steam comes OpenGL library is outdated, run may complain about something "Can not find OpenGL GX" and the like, see ArchWiki "steam" entry, delete the steam that comes with several libraries.

2. But then delete those libraries steam comes you need to install the new version of the library in the system, other than the 64-bit library remove (unlikely there are people in the 32-bit system with it), to see if there 'lib32- mesa "and" lib32-mesa-libgl "dual graphics cards also need to install lib32" lib32-intel-dri "do not ask why, do not install the card, then will be very, very," primusrun "will quietly fail," optirun "will prompt" can not find opengl entry point xxxx " something like.

3. NVIDIA drivers need to install "nvidia" instead of "nouveau" install "nvidia-utils" and "lib32-nvidia-utils" . But when the "bumblebee" may be dependent on the installation of the conflict, see "bumblebee" entry ArchWiki, as if to install "intel-dri", "xf86-video - intel", "bumblebee" and "nvidia" to circumvent reliance conflict.

4. "bumblebee" is used to switch alone was something to run a program, but "startx" into the desktop environment or use of Intel graphics core, so do not generate "xorg.conf", if your system has any legitimate the "xorg.conf", or whether it is under the home directory "/ etc / X11", delete it or change the names will not be detected, or you may not start X11. Of course, you have to configure bumblebee good job, "optirun glxgears -info" to see if there is no information output "NVIDIA" indication, the output is a good job.

5. dota2 not use "optirun" run up, install "primus" package, use the "primusrun" to run, of course, do not run in a virtual terminal dota2, a setback that too. steam in the right dota2, "Properties" in "SET LUNACH OPTIONS ..." fill inside "vblank_mode = 0 primusrun% command%" of course, is a global service, if you play a perfect world, the national service agency to fill "vblank_mode = 0 primusrun% command% -language schinese -international -perfectworld . "

6. If you are using a previously open source drivers, N card driver switches from the nouveau need to rebuild the kernel image after the nvidia, take a look at "/etc/mkinitcpio.conf" comment out all the nouveau module, then "sudo mkinitcpio -p linux "after the restart," dmesg "to see the information in the information nouveau" and "nvidia" no words ", should the former not the latter there.

7. This one is not anything important, because we are dual graphics cards, only time will run manually switch 3D graphics, usually are used in Intel graphics core, so no need to add "nomodeset" kernel parameter to disable kms.

8. to say that is not BUG feature, steam installation of perfect proxy dota2 run national service beginning is not full-screen, set up in the upper left corner of the video to find the bar into "full-screen" like the past seems to be "What no window" sort of thing, the game screen will be covered Xfce4 panel, very boring.


Transfer: https://blog.csdn.net/iSpeller/article/details/37765999

 

Guess you like

Origin www.cnblogs.com/mc-r/p/11424597.html